Bob Murray

NAUGATUCK — Bob Murray, 71, of Naugatuck, passed away peacefully on Thursday, Jan. 8, 2015 at Waterbury Hospital after a long battle with cancer.

Born in Patterson, N.J., on Dec. 7, 1943, he was the oldest son of the late Alexander and Mary Murray. He graduated with the Class of 1961 from Paramus High School. After a brief time in the Navy, he worked for 44 years for Pathmark supermarkets, starting in New Jersey and then transferring to Connecticut, retiring in 2005. He was married on Sept. 9, 1967 to Joyce (LaMarta) Murray. Together they have enjoyed spending time with family (especially the grandchildren), collecting Dept. 56 houses and figures, adopting greyhounds, reading and travelling to places like Canada, Martha Vineyards, the New Jersey Shore and Disney World. Bob was known for being able to entertain family and friends with stories.

Besides his wife of 46 years he is survived by his children, Dawn Johnston and her husband, Greg, of Bethel, Brian Murray and his wife, Colleen, of Wallingford; his grandchildren, Cameron and Kyle Johnston, Shannon, Erin, and Autumn Murray; siblings, brother, David Murray and his wife, Denise, of Pompton Lakes, N.J., and sister, Jan Bloomer and husband, Paul, of Vernon, N.J.; several nieces and nephews. He was preceded in death by his brother, Allan Murray of New Jersey.
